BMI honors Rodney Clawson as top songwriter, ‘Wanted’ as song of year

Rodney Clawson, who co-wrote several of the past year’s radio hits, is performing rights organization BMI’s 2013 songwriter of the year.

Clawson, whose recent successes include Blake Shelton’s ‘Drink On It,” Luke Bryan’s “Drunk On You,” Tim McGraw’s “One of Those Nights,” Jason Aldean’s “Take a Little Ride,” Montgomery Gentry’s “Where I Come From” and Greg Bates’ “Did It For The Girl,” was honored at Tuesday’s 2013 BMI Country Awards, held at Broadcast Music, Inc.’s Music Row offices.

Clawson, who gave up farming in Texas to come to Nashville at the urging of friend John Rich, moved to Nashville 10 years ago. Since then, he has written 11 No. 1 country songs.

“It’s been cool to see what’s happened with his career,” Aldean said. “He’s written some big songs for us, like ‘Amarillo Sky’ and ‘Johnny Cash.’ I think it makes a song great when someone who is writing it has lived the songs. Rodney writes songs that are believable because he has lived them.”

Hunter Hayes’ “Wanted,” a chart-topping, Grammy-nominated song co-written by Hayes and  Troy Verges, won the Song of the Year award.

On the red carpet before the ceremony, Hayes said of the love song that giving a voice to millions of people with those same emotions “is exactly what you dream about for every song you write and nothing you expect for any song you write. I’ve been blown away. You want to be somebody’s soundtrack, every song you write. I never dreamed this song would do that.”

Sony/ATV Music Publishing Nashville won BMI’s Publisher of the Year award for an unequaled 37th time in the show’s 61 years. Sony/ATV published 20 of BMI’s 50 most-performed songs of the year, including Florida Georgia Line’s “Cruise,” Little Big Town’s “Pontoon,” Dierks Bentley’s “Tip It On Back” and Toby Keith’s “Red Solo Cup.”

Some of the night’s most emotionally compelling moments came during the late-night multi-artist celebration of Dean Dillon, who received a BMI Icon Award. Dillon joins a sterling list of previous winners including Kris Kristofferson, Dolly Parton, Loretta Lynn, Merle Haggard, Hank Williams, Bobby Braddock, Bill Anderson and Tom T. Hall.

The Icon prize is given for “a unique and indelible influence on generations of music makers,” and Dillon’s hits include George Jones’ “Tennessee Whiskey,” Kenny Chesney’s “A Lot Of Things Different,” Vern Gosdin’s “Is It Raining At Your House” and a remarkable 54 songs recorded by George Strait.

Forty years ago, Dillon hitchhiked to Nashville from East Tennessee, to pursue his dreams of writing and singing. He’s written more than 90 charted songs since then, including 26 that have been played more than a million times on country radio stations. He’s won a combined total of 31 BMI Country and Pop awards, and was inducted into the Nashville Songwriters Hall of Fame in 2002.

“Listening to the songs he’s written, it motivates all of us to keep writing,” said Miranda Lambert, who grew up in Texas, internalizing Dillon’s music and lyrics. “I’m so happy for him, and so glad he’s being honored.”

Luke Bryan, Lee Ann Womack and Kenny Chesney performed Dillon’s songs at the show, and Strait appeared to perform a few of his Dillon-written smashes, “The Chair,” “Marina Del Ray” and “Here For A Good Time.”

“I got a ride with a hippie, in an old ’66, Chevrolet station wagon, and he dropped me off in Nashville,” Dillon said. “I can’t remember where I slept that first night.

“But I got up the next day, asked somebody where Music Row was, and started beating on doors. I knew I had to pursue what I had in my heart. When I heard about this award, in my head I could see those names — Kristofferson, Tom T. Hall, Bobby Braddock and Willie — and I’m thinking, ‘Take all those names and put ‘Dean Dillon’ with them? It felt weird. But I’ve given my life to country music, and you have to understand, it’s nice to be here.”

2013 BMI COUNTRY AWARDS

SONG OF THE YEAR: “Wanted," Hunter Hayes and  Troy Verges; Happy Little Man Publishing; Songs From the Engine Room; Songs of Universal, Inc.
SONGWRITER OF THE YEAR: Rodney Clawson
PUBLISHER OF THE YEAR: Sony/ATV Music Publishing Nashville (EMI-Blackwood Music, Inc, Sony/ATV Countryside, Sony/ATV Songs LLC and Sony/ATV Tree)
ICON: Dean Dillon
